[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: In TabVoice - how to avoid: "programming error: side-axis not set fo
From: |
Werner LEMBERG |
Subject: |
Re: In TabVoice - how to avoid: "programming error: side-axis not set for grob StrokeFinger" |
Date: |
Tue, 10 Mar 2020 10:36:31 +0100 (CET) |
> In order to avoid this problem of sequence, I've first removed
> Script_column_engraver and appended it again /after/
> New_fingering_engraver. Looks funny but actually solves the
> problem.
>
> [...]
> \remove "Script_column_engraver"
> \consists "New_fingering_engraver" % *before* Script_column_engraver!
> \consists "Script_column_engraver"
Interesting. Is it documented somewhere that the order of `\consists`
calls is relevant (sometimes)? Or rather, is there an example in the
documentation or the regression test suite that demonstrates the
importance of the right order?
Or maybe there is a bug somewhere? I think not having to think about
the order would be quite beneficial. I think I would prefer setting a
property or the like to get the desired result.
Werner